Understanding Sash Windows

Sash windows are made from frames that hold several movable panels, or "sashes," which can move vertically or horizontally. They are typically built from wood, which can be prone to weather damage, rot, and other issues gradually. Proper care and timely servicing can substantially extend their lifespan while improving the total looks of a home.

Typical Issues with Sash Windows

ConcernDescriptionPossible Solutions
DraftsSash windows can develop spaces gradually, permitting drafts to go into the home.Weatherstripping or sealing gaps can help get rid of drafts.
Decaying FrameExposure to wetness can cause wood rot in the frame.Change decomposing sections or apply wood hardener.
Sticking SashesPaint build-up or misalignment can cause sashes to stick.Routine cleaning and lubrication can relieve this problem.
Broken GlassGlass can break due to weather or accidents.Replace the glass pane and reseal the window.
Poor InsulationOlder windows may not insulate in addition to modern-day options.Consider secondary glazing or including insulation packages.
Sound pollutionSash windows are often less soundproof compared to modern windows.Set up acoustic glass or heavier drapes.

How to Care for Sash Windows

Maintaining sash windows can be a workable task for property owners. Here are some advised steps:

Routine Maintenance Checklist

  1. Visual Inspections: Regularly inspect for any noticeable signs of damage, consisting of cracks or broken glass.
  2. Cleaning up: Keep the frames and sashes tidy from dirt and debris. Utilize a wet cloth and a moderate cleaning agent.
  3. Examine for Drafts: On windy days, feel for drafts and inspect spaces. Weatherstripping can be applied where  learn more .
  4. Lube Mechanisms: Ensure the operational systems, such as pulleys and cables, are well-lubricated.
  5. Inspect Paint: Check the paint for peeling or breaking. Repainting may be essential to protect the wood from wetness.

When to Seek Professional Help

While many upkeep tasks can be done by house owners, some repairs ought to be left to specialists. Think about employing a sash window professional if:

  • The damage is substantial, such as structural rot.
  • There is broken glass needing replacement.
  • You are unknown with appropriate repair techniques.
  • You are uncertain how to bring back the window to its original weight balance.

FAQs About Sash Windows Repair and Servicing

Q1: How typically ought to I service my sash windows?It is suggested to carry out a comprehensive evaluation at least when a year. Routine cleaning and minor modifications ought to be done every few months.

Q2: Can I repair my sash windows myself?Many small repairs and maintenance jobs can be DIY jobs. Nevertheless, for considerable issues like wood rot or glass replacement, it's recommended to seek advice from a professional. Q3: What is the average expense for sash window

repair?The expense for repair work differs substantially based on the degree of damage and the materials needed. Typically, house owners can anticipate to pay in between ₤ 150 to ₤ 500 per window for various kinds of repairs. Q4: How can I enhance the energy effectiveness of my sash windows?Consider setting up secondary glazing, draft excluders, or insulating drapes.
